Ask anyone in Glasgow to name a pub and many of them will say The Scotia. We have been serving the people of Glasgow for over two hundred years and most Glaswegians have paid us a visit at some time in their lives.
We serve a wide range of good quality beers and ales including our own Belhaven Best. If you prefer something a little stronger then we have a fantastic range of spirits and liqueurs and in keeping with our traditional values we stock a good range of malt whiskies from all over Scotland.
If you like to mix your food and drink with great company and good live music then step through our doors. We have the very best bands playing in Glasgow and four days a week you can hear anything from rock to country, from blues to folk. Music is our passion and that's what makes us one of Glasgow's premier live music venues.
But if you prefer to do it for yourself then come along with your guitar or even your spoons and we're sure you'll find someone ready and willing to jam with you. Most Scotia folk love a good singsong and we keep a pub guitar handy just in case the notion takes us.
